Affle to acquire 8.0 per cent ownership in Bobble AI

Affle has entered into a definitive share subscription agreement as well as into shareholders’ agreement to acquire 8.0 per cent ownership in Talent Unlimited Online Services Private Limited (Bobble AI) incorporated in India.

The company has also secured an option to own and acquire incremental ownership on the attainment of certain key performance targets within the next three years.

Prior to Affle’s investment in Bobble AI, its major investors were Xiaomi and SAIF Partners. Post this investment, the shareholding of major investors in Bobble AI, i.e. Xiaomi would have 27.60 per cent and that of SAIF Partners, it would be 19.42 per cent.  

Bobble AI is a strategic investment for Affle as it owns and operates ‘Bobble Indic Keyboard’, an indigenous social keyboard with investments from Xiaomi and SAIF Partners.

Bobble Indic Keyboard includes speech-to-text capabilities and is accessible in multiple Indian languages. It is also a pre-loaded default keyboard for Xiaomi across multiple devices in India, thereby, enhancing Affle’s vernacular strategy and OEM partnerships.

The stock closed at 2148.85, up by 1.76 per cent or Rs 37.10 per share. The intraday high is Rs 2198.30 and the intraday low is Rs 2100.
